Is there an industry average for annual lot rental increases?

Re: Lot Rental Increases

Posted: Sun Aug 22, 2004 7:39 pm
by Chrissy Jackson
No, there really isn't. Many different factors come into play when computing rent increases, and one of the most important is to consider the terms set forth in the lease and all other state required documents.
